Abstract

Purpose—The paper aims to examine the impact of good corporate governance on the quality of financial reports using the mediation effect of information technology utilization. Methodology—This study was conducted in all Lembaga Perkreditan Desa (LPDs) in Bali. The study population included 1,334 LPDs based on data from Bali LP-LPDs as of 2022. The objects in this study include good corporate governance, the use of information technology, and the quality of LPD financial reports. The research sample was 299, which was determined based on a proportionate stratified random sampling design. Findings— The findings indicate that the use of sound corporate governance principles is very important to ensure better and more reliable financial report quality. The use of information technology is able to mediate the relationship between good corporate governance and the quality of financial reports. This shows that the application of information technology in an organization can act as a link between the tenets of effective corporate governance and the integrity of financial statements. Research limitations—The limitation of this study is that was conducted at LPDs in Bali, so caution is needed in generalizing the research results. The R Square value is 64.4%, so that indicates that there are numerous more elements influence the quality of financial reports. Paper type— research paper.

Abstract

Digital transformation has changed the face of the music industry in Indonesia. Music can now be easily accessed, disseminated, and enjoyed through various digital platforms. However, this convenience is not accompanied by adequate legal protection of copyright, especially in the context of digital transmission. The Electronic Information and Transaction Law (ITE Law) has not explicitly protected musical works from violations committed in the digital realm. This paper examines the urgency of reforming the ITE Law in ensuring legal protection of music copyright, through a normative approach with an analysis of laws and regulations and scientific literature. The results of the study show that the revision of the ITE Law is crucial to accommodate technological developments and the creative economy, as well as provide legal certainty for music industry creators and players.

Abstract

There have been many studies about the effectiveness of differentiated instruction in promoting student-centered learning. However, most of these studies have focused on primary and secondary education. There is hardly any research about its application and effectiveness in higher education settings. Furthermore, there is a need to identify the factors that influence information technology or information technology (IT) students’ motivation, engagement and attitude towards learning to use appropriate instructional strategies. The current research addresses this gap in the literature by investigating the perspectives of university IT students on differentiated instruction and its impact on their learning attitude. A mixed-methods approach was employed, combining survey questionnaires and semi-structured interviews to examine the effectiveness of various instructional strategies, including scaffolded instruction, peer-assisted learning, collaborative learning, and competitive learning, across different IT courses. The results showed that students had a positive attitude toward differentiated instruction. Respondents reported that the tailored teaching methods helped them better engage with the course material and develop more effective learning strategies. Many students stated that the differentiated approach allowed them to capitalize on their strengths and address their weaknesses in a supportive environment. The findings have implications for educators seeking to promote student-centered learning and improve learning outcomes in IT courses.

Abstract

Perkembangan teknologi informasi kesehatan (Health Information Technology/HIT) telah mengubah sistem pelayanan kesehatan melalui penerapan rekam medis elektronik, sistem pendukung keputusan klinis, telemedisin, dan integrasi data lintas fasilitas. Namun, tantangan seperti infrastruktur terbatas, biaya implementasi, dan kurangnya interoperabilitas sering menghambat adopsi HIT, terutama di negara berkembang seperti Indonesia. Penelitian ini bertujuan mengevaluasi tingkat kematangan penerapan HIT di institusi kesehatan menggunakan Health Information Technology Maturity Model (HITMM) dengan lima dimensi utama: infrastruktur TI, pengelolaan data dan informasi, interoperabilitas, penggunaan sistem klinis, dan keamanan informasi. Menggunakan pendekatan kuantitatif, data dikumpulkan melalui kuesioner terstruktur dari 30 tenaga kesehatan di sebuah institusi layanan kesehatan. Hasil evaluasi menunjukkan tingkat kematangan rata-rata 4,1 (Level 4), dengan interoperabilitas sebagai dimensi terlemah (skor 3,9). Rekomendasi strategis meliputi peningkatan interoperabilitas melalui standar global seperti HL7/FHIR, pelatihan keamanan siber, dan integrasi kecerdasan buatan. Penelitian ini memberikan panduan bagi institusi kesehatan untuk meningkatkan kapabilitas sistem informasi guna mendukung pelayanan kesehatan yang berkelanjutan dan berkualitas.

Abstract

Correspondence at Politeknik Negeri Tanah Laut (Politala) is currently still done manually in the vertical delivery process between work units. This manual process results in inefficiency, especially in monitoring the status of documents such as Staff Review Documents. Staff Review is a document that must be made by the department to the director as a basis for requesting assignment letters, decrees, recommendation letters and the others. These documents often require repeated checking, causing delays in the workflow. In addition, paper-based correspondence archives increase the risk of losing documents and make it difficult to find them again. Therefore, the implementation of the Correspondence Management Information System (SiMantan) is needed to improve the efficiency of the correspondence administration process by providing electronic document management and real-time status monitoring. This information system is built using the waterfall development model and designed with the Unified Modeling Language (UML) in the form of Usecase Diagrams. While the programming language used is the PHP programming language with the Code Ignitor 3 framework and MySQL database. Functional testing of the system is carried out using the black box testing and user acceptance testing (UAT) method which shows that all features in the information system function properly according to the expected specifications.
